Output 630f43e06c1e6f3039b56b1b0f7bce7c5ada0c69665c70dbdf06a48f24814081:14
- value
- 567546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 886b0f43221e7d68e41000f41fcbcc07c368ad24 OP_EQUAL
- address
- 3E8L5GLwke121xXLthycuoXb7T4bQLJNVq
- transaction
- 630f43e06c1e6f3039b56b1b0f7bce7c5ada0c69665c70dbdf06a48f24814081
- confirmations
- 84402
- spent
- true